| --------------------------- |
| -- Exception_Information -- |
| --------------------------- |
| |
| -- The format of the string is: |
| |
| -- Exception_Name: nnnnn |
| -- Message: mmmmm |
| -- PID: ppp |
| -- Call stack traceback locations: |
| -- 0xhhhh 0xhhhh 0xhhhh ... 0xhhh |
| |
| -- where |
| |
| -- nnnn is the fully qualified name of the exception in all upper |
| -- case letters. This line is always present. |
| |
| -- mmmm is the message (this line present only if message is non-null) |
| |
| -- ppp is the Process Id value as a decimal integer (this line is |
| -- present only if the Process Id is non-zero). Currently we are |
| -- not making use of this field. |
| |
| -- The Call stack traceback locations line and the following values |
| -- are present only if at least one traceback location was recorded. |
| -- the values are given in C style format, with lower case letters |
| -- for a-f, and only as many digits present as are necessary. |
| |
| -- The line terminator sequence at the end of each line, including the |
| -- last line is a CR-LF sequence (16#0D# followed by 16#0A#). |
| |
| -- The Exception_Name and Message lines are omitted in the abort |
| -- signal case, since this is not really an exception, and the only |
| -- use of this routine is internal for printing termination output. |
| |
| -- WARNING: if the format of the generated string is changed, please note |
| -- that an equivalent modification to the routine String_To_EO must be |
| -- made to preserve proper functioning of the stream attributes. |
| |
| function Exception_Information (X : Exception_Occurrence) return String is |
| |
| -- This information is now built using the circuitry introduced in |
| -- association with the support of traceback decorators, as the |
| -- catenation of the exception basic information and the call chain |
| -- backtrace in its basic form. |
| |
| Basic_Info : constant String := Basic_Exception_Information (X); |
| Tback_Info : constant String := Basic_Exception_Traceback (X); |
| |
| Basic_Len : constant Natural := Basic_Info'Length; |
| Tback_Len : constant Natural := Tback_Info'Length; |
| |
| Info : String (1 .. Basic_Len + Tback_Len); |
| Ptr : Natural := 0; |
| |
| begin |
| Append_Info_String (Basic_Info, Info, Ptr); |
| Append_Info_String (Tback_Info, Info, Ptr); |
| |
| return Info; |
| end Exception_Information; |

| ---------------------------------- |
| -- Tailored_Exception_Traceback -- |
| ---------------------------------- |
| |
| function Tailored_Exception_Traceback |
| (X : Exception_Occurrence) return String |
| is |
| -- We indeed reference the decorator *wrapper* from here and not the |
| -- decorator itself. The purpose of the local variable Wrapper is to |
| -- prevent a potential crash by race condition in the code below. The |
| -- atomicity of this assignment is enforced by pragma Atomic in |
| -- System.Soft_Links. |
| |
| -- The potential race condition here, if no local variable was used, |
| -- relates to the test upon the wrapper's value and the call, which |
| -- are not performed atomically. With the local variable, potential |
| -- changes of the wrapper's global value between the test and the |
| -- call become inoffensive. |
| |
| Wrapper : constant Traceback_Decorator_Wrapper_Call := |
| Traceback_Decorator_Wrapper; |
| |
| begin |
| if Wrapper = null then |
| return Basic_Exception_Traceback (X); |
| else |
| return Wrapper.all (X.Tracebacks'Address, X.Num_Tracebacks); |
| end if; |
| end Tailored_Exception_Traceback; |
